Transaction dfc40a184d10323ba70f9140f4f9115be521877c79973ced1c257f3bf16b6fa5

2 Input
2 Outputs
  • dfc40a184d10323ba70f9140f4f9115be521877c79973ced1c257f3bf16b6fa5:0
  • value  33666
    address  134gWReoXeqtHujTHcZJgdXf5tY2raaGHR
  • dfc40a184d10323ba70f9140f4f9115be521877c79973ced1c257f3bf16b6fa5:1
  • value  100000
    address  3Ku6VjXB8AxLTM9SsHtfMkRfDeQ8i6L8NR